Distoken Acquisition to Merge With Youlife International
May 20, 2024 8:21 AM

10:56 AM EDT, 05/20/2024 (MT Newswires) -- Distoken Acquisition ( DIST ) and Youlife International Holdings said Monday they will combine, with Distoken becoming the vehicle for Youlife to debut on the Nasdaq Stock Market.

Once the deal is completed, the combined company will trade under the YOUL ticker symbol, they said.

Distoken will provide strategic support and financial resources for Youlife in addition to creating a capital platform for the company in the US stock markets. More information will become available through regulatory filings with the US Securities and Exchange Commission, the companies said.

Distoken shares were fractionally higher in recent mid-morning trading.
